I know. It seems Misskey/Sharkey/Akkoma/etc. support a bunch of nonstandard effects like rainbow color cycles and bouncing jelly animations. Absolutely none of those $[command] commands work on Mbin or Lemmy.

But somehow, when viewing @[email protected] Sharkey profile in Mbin, those non-Markdown tags all get stripped out gracefully. It looks like the same doesn't happen when an Mbin user tries to use those commands.

In Piefed a different subset of those tags from that Sharkey profile make it through. Somehow, this includes the HTML tag. ... just in case, .

The string ${i18n.ts._mfm.dummy} is meant to be replaced with "Sharkey expands the world of the Fediverse" or its localized equivalent.
